Sébastien Deguy is a name familiar to those in 3D content creation, first as founder of Allegorithmic, maker of 3D DCC tools, and then at Adobe, where he signed on following their acquisition of his company. Now, Deguy, who has enabled so many to achieve their creative dreams, is pursuing his own creative passions.Sébastien Deguy celebrated May by announcing his departure from Adobe, where he headed 3D & Immersive. He had been at Adobe since January 2019.

Based in Espoo, Finland, IXI Eyewear promises to deliver glasses that can adapt to deliver a clear vision of what the view is looking at. The company has come out of semi-stealth mode with $36.5 million series A round of funding.IXI, the newly emerged Finnish company developing autofocus eyewear, hasn’t exactly been flying under the radar before now. They’ve been skimming the surface of the tech world’s consciousness since their founding by Ville Miettinen and Niko Eiden in 2021 (as Pixieray).

There was a time when RED and Nikon were more foes than friends, facing off in court over patent infringements. But that is water under the bridge, as the fairly new kid (albeit an aggressive one) on the pro digital cinema block and the longtime still camera maker have set aside their differences. After all, that is what business partners do, now that the two are family. RED is now a subsidiary of Nikon following their recent acquisition.

At SXSW 2024, Lisa Su, CEO of AMD, addressed a tech-savvy audience focused on immediate financial gains. Despite discussing AI PCs, interest seemed tepid, with attendees hesitant to upgrade for AI capabilities. Tech giants like AMD, Intel, Microsoft, Nvidia, and Qualcomm envision similar AI PC concepts, but users are holding on to devices longer and relying on server-based capabilities. Apple’s M3 chip with a 16-core Neural Engine competes in the AI PC market.

Fast Company has reported layoffs at design consultancy Ideo and has commented on a decline in the company’s fortunes since 2020. A former employee has told the magazine that revenues have declined from $300 million to $100 million in 2023. Mistakes were made, and unfavorable market shifts have not helped. Now, a streamlined company with a new CEO at the helm will have a chance to redesign itself at a time when absolutely everything about doing business is changing. What do we think?
